Steering Wheel Interface(SWI) Operation
In the event of the interface, you can set the function value of the button, touch the
N/A area will pop-up the value, touch the button up or down to search the function
value. When the selected value to touch it determine the value by the button; You can
set the unit’s system a total of six buttons, there are ten optional functions: VOL-/VOL
(volume adjustment), CH-/CH(TV channel scan), SEEK-/SEEK(manual ne-tuning(short
press)/scan channels(long press), MUTE, MODE, POWER, Talk; Will be set after the
button above. Pressing [return] icon after setting. As shown below:
From the point we can see, setting up ve buttons, set the VOL+,VOL-,CH+,CH-, MODE
ve functions according to individual needs, set the button’s function corresponding value.
When the need to re-set button on the steering wheel controller efunction value, touch
[RESET] button to life the value of the button’s function, then repeat the above steps,
re-set the desired fuction value.
